Deezer surveys listeners on album streaming preferences

Posted on January 28, 2020 by Anna Washenko

Deezer released data tracing listeners’ habits surrounding album streaming. In the survey of 8,000 people from the U.S., France, Germany, and Brazil, 54% said they listen to fewer albums than their did 5 to 10 years ago. Continue Reading →

SoundExchange reached 2019 distributions of $908.2 million

Posted on January 28, 2020 by Anna Washenko

SoundExchange released its statistics from the final quarter of 2019. The organization distributed $218.8 million during the period for a total of $908.2 million during the whole year. Continue Reading →
